Automatically create purchase orders when issuing sales orders

Rules can be very powerful for getting Paragon to perform in a specific way.  Knowing that your ERP system is working in line with your ever changing business processes is always nice, too.

Paragon can automatically create purchase orders based on requested products in sales orders.  We have now adjusted that setup to also populate the purchase order number on the sales order lines once an automatic PO has been created.

Step 1 - Free flow text attributes

Create a free flow text attribute to represent PO number.  For more information about creating free flow attributes click here.


 

Step 2 - Screen setup

Add that new attribute to the order screen setup - line attributes.  For more information about using screen setup click here.



Step 3 - Attribute inheritance

Now we need to make sure that the PO number attribute we just setup is inherited from sales order lines to shipment lines.  For more information about setting up attribute inheritance click here.



Step 4 - Install rule

Make sure the automated PO creation rule has been installed on a trigger and is activated.  To do this:

Navigate to the rules module from the settings screen:



Add the rules script to the after_issue_order trigger (by clicking on import and selecting the file from your directory), name the rule and activate it.











 

Step 5 - Create and issue a sales order

Create a sales order and issue it to see the automatic purchase order(s) created and to see that the PO Number attribute on the sales order lines is filled.






Now purchase orders were automatically created based on your sales order - and you can always see the related PO number in the attributes of each order line.
